What are castration tools called?

Burdizzo

The burdizzo is a castration device which employs a large clamp designed to break the blood vessels leading into the testicles.

What is an elastrator ring?

Elastrator Rings, 100/pk: sc-363298. Rubber rings designed to be used with an elastrator for castrating lambs, calves, goats and other animals. A rubber ring is placed over the scrotum to castrate, or over a lamb’s tail to dock.

What is a elastrator used for?

An elastrator uses a tool that stretches a heavy-duty rubber band (elastrator band) over the scrotum and testicles. It takes approximately two weeks for the scrotum to dry up and fall off. When using an elastrator band for castrating, be sure to check that both testicles are in the scrotum below the band.

How long after banding do balls fall off?

2 to 3 weeks
The testicles and scrotum will shrivel and fall off in 2 to 3 weeks after application of the band. This method does not put the animal at risk of hemorrhage, but does carry a higher likelihood of tetanus if the animal is not properly vaccinated.

Is banding castration painful?

Chronic pain—Persistent wounds were observed in 14-month-old bull calves castrated using emasculator bands; these wounds may produce chronic pain. Assessment of chronic pain has primarily been based on reduced weight gain and growth, but findings suggest that pain may persist for several weeks following castration.

What is the difference between Burdizzo and emasculator?

The primary difference between surgical castration of cattle and using a Burdizzo (emasculator) is whether the wound is open or not. Both require a bit of skill to do correctly; however, the Burdizzo is more likely to fail to castrate the animal effectively than the use of surgical castration.

How long does it take for a banded calves balls to fall off?

two to four weeks
After banding, calves will often show discomfort by rolling on the ground or kicking at their belly for up to 30 min- utes. The calf’s scrotum should dry up and fall off in two to four weeks. Rubber banding methods have been developed for use in older, heavier cattle.

Is it better to band or cut bull calves?

Calves that are cut will have pain for a short time but tend to heal quickly and return to a steady rate of gain. Banded calves are fine at first but suffer irritation and pain a few weeks later when the band cuts through the dead skin and the dried-up scrotum and testicles are ready to fall off.

How can I neuter my cat without surgery?

Non-surgical sterilization for dogs, cats and small animals — Calcium chloride dihydrate solution is a chemical sterilant for male animals that is administered via intratesticular injection. It can be obtained through a compounding pharmacy or in pre-measured doses that can be mixed onsite.

Can you neuter an animal with a rubber band?

Banding is a routinely done method for neutering livestock, mainly young sheep and cattle. The tight rubber band restricts circulation causing the scrotum and testicles to shrivel and eventually just fall off with little complication.

Is Zeuterin still available?

Please note that as of early 2016, Zeuterin is no longer available but was approved by the FDA. Zeuterin/Esterisol was an intra-testicular injection of zinc gluconate neutralized by arginine that reduced — but did not eliminate — testosterone in male dogs.
